Javascript parseFloat 和空值
全部标签 我目前在我的代码中执行2个步骤,我刚刚意识到我可以在一个LUA脚本中组合这两个步骤。我在做:在我的设备上SPOP调用lua脚本做其他事情。第1步的值被传递并存储在局部变量ele中。我的lua脚本是这样的:localele=KEYS[1]localp=KEYS[2]localu=KEYS[3]ifredis.call("SISMEMBER",u,ele)==0then....return"OK"elsereturn"EXISTS"end如何从我的lua脚本中调用SPOP并将其存储在变量中。我需要做的:localpopped=redis.call("SPOP","my-set-here")
你能帮我看看我走的路是否正确吗?我是SQL的新手,所以有很多事情对我来说并不明显。假设我有两个表。第一个是订阅者列表:subscribers+--------+------------+|subscID|name|+--------+------------+|123|SomeName00||456|SomeName01||789|SomeName02||012|SomeName03||345|SomeName04|+--------+------------+第二个是通话记录(或类似的东西),包括订阅者的收入和支出以及交易ID和他们账户的当前状态:transactions+-----
如何在进行交叉表查询时计算空值?我有一个包含三列的表格[id,name,answer]我有以下记录:IDNAMEANS1ABC11ABC01ABCNULL2XYZ12XYZNULL2XYZNULL2XYZ12XYZ01ABC0现在我想得到我的结果:IDNameNULLCOUNTTRUECOUNTFALSECOUNT1ABC1122XYZ221我正在使用以下SQL语句:selectID,NAME,sum(caseANSwhennullthen1else0end)asNULLCOUNT,sum(caseANSwhen1then1else0end)asTRUECOUNT,sum(caseAN
我试图在数据库中插入FALSE值,但没有任何运气-它插入了一个空字符串。该列是varchar。如果我插入TRUE值,它会插入1。我正在使用mysql、PDO和php。我还使用了一个DB类,它除了使用PDO准备语句准备和执行查询之外,对查询没有做任何其他事情。心中的查询是一个非常基本的查询:$sql='INSERTINTOapi_logs_values(value)VALUES(?)';然后:$this->_db->query($sql,array(FALSE));知道发生了什么吗?编辑:添加表结构:api_logs_values|CREATETABLE`api_logs_values`
数据库架构我有这个字段:标题(字符串)副标题描述(字符串)将默认值设置为空字符串''还是NULL更好?为了更好的读/写和大小存储性能 最佳答案 通常的契约是:NULL表示“无可用信息”。''表示“有可用的信息。它只是空的。”除此之外,自NULL在任何语言中发明以来,还有很多哲学讨论,而不仅仅是SQL。这里唯一的技术要点是:在PostgreSQL中,NULL可以比长度为零的字符串更有效地存储。如果这对你的情况真的很重要......我们无法知道。 关于mysql-使用空值作为''还是NULL
我在做:selectsum(clicks),datefromstatsgroupbydate...然而,当某个日期的总和为空时,整行将被丢弃,我想看看:|空|some_date|,怎么做? 最佳答案 这将有助于查看所讨论的完整查询。对于stats中存在的每个日期值,您应该为Sum获取NULL或一个整数值。如果您按[Date]分组并且给定的日期值不存在,它显然不会显示。例如,考虑以下测试:CreateTableTest(Clicksintnull,[Date]datetimenull)InsertTest(Clicks,[Date])
好的,这是我的问题:在我开始描述之前,让我告诉你,我已经在谷歌上搜索了很多,我发布这个问题是为了寻找一个好的最佳解决方案:)我正在WCF上构建休息服务以获取userProfiles...用户可以通过提供类似userProfiles?location=London的内容来过滤userProfiles现在我有以下方法GetUserProfiles(stringfirstname,stringlastname,stringage,stringlocation)我构建的sql查询字符串是:selectfirstname,lastname,....fromprofileswhere(firstN
我正在尝试使用peeweewithbottle在MySQL数据库的某些列中允许空值。查看文档here我以为那会很容易。我设置了这样一个类:classTestClass(MySQLModel):Title=pw.CharField(null=True)创建表并尝试像这样插入一个空值:myDB.connect()x=TestClass.create(Title=None)x.save()只是因为它挂断了我的电话并说“_mysql_exceptions.OperationalError:(1048,“Column'Title'cannotbenull”)”。我做错了什么吗?
我有这样的表:表1:id|item_name|entered_by|modify_by1|banana|2|12|apple|4|33|orance|1|14|pineapple|5|35|grape|6|1表2:id|username1|admin2|jack3|danny4|dummy5|john6|peter查询可以很好地选择entered_by或modify_by是否具有值:SELECTt1.id,t1.item_name,t2enteredBy.usernameenteredBy,t2modifyBy.usernamemodifyByFROMtable1t1JOINtable
我不确定如何完美地表达这一点,但让我试一试。我正在构建一个库存控制应用程序,供许多不同的客户使用,以执行从检查他们自己的元素库存、获取价格、订购产品等所有事情。前端在Flex(FlashBuilder)中,而在后端最后是MySQL和PHP。所以-我想这是真正的问题。当客户下订单购买产品时,我不确定他们订购了多少,但我需要将所有商品保存到一张“票”上。(示例:一个订单可能是2个苹果、3个橙子、一个香蕉和一个奇异果-下一个订单可能只订购一个苹果。)所以在我的“门票”数据库中,我有空间容纳最多20个项目(ticketItem1,ticketItem2等...)-这里明显的缺点是,如果客户只订